Bio
Kevin Chen is currently the D. Reid Weedon, Jr. ’41 Career Development Assistant Professor at the Department of Electrical Engineering and Computer Science, MIT. He received his PhD in Engineering Sciences at Harvard University in 2017 and his bachelor’s degree in Applied and Engineering Physics from Cornell University in 2012. His work focuses on developing multifunctional and multimodal insect-scale robots. His research interests also include developing high bandwidth and robust soft actuators for microrobot manipulation and locomotion. He is a recipient of the several best paper awards at top robotics journals and conferences such as TRO 2021, RAL 2020, and IROS 2015.
My research is focused on modelling complex dynamical systems and on investigating the associated fluid mechanical interactions. I take a hybrid experimental and computational approach towards understanding the aerodynamic principles of flapping wing systems. Experimental and computational studies of biological and robotic systems lead to new locomotive strategies for robotic designs.
